#ca35c4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ca35c4 is composed of 79.2% red, 20.8%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.8% magenta, 3%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 302.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.4% and a lightness of 50%. #ca35c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6aff with #950089.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#ca35c4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10040f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ca35c4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#857a85 is the less saturated color, while #fb04f1 is the most saturated one.
